Frequently Asked Questions
What kind of clients do you partner with?
At TTM, we pride ourselves on making it possible for everyone with a passion for thoroughbreds to be involved. Our exceptionally diverse partner pool consists of modest income to high net worth individuals and groups of first-time investors who want less risk by sharing the investment. Some of our investment partners simply wish to be updated electronically quarterly. In contrast, others love the thrill of visiting the farm, the track, and the sales with us. We strive to deliver the experience that best meets your goals and comfort level.
What is the average investment of your partners?
We have partners that invest in a 10% share of a single Pinhook as part of a group, to those that have diversified a sizeable financial investment across multiple service lines. We feel that each client is a valued part of the TTM team!
How do you determine which trainer to send a horse to?
Having decades of experience in the thoroughbred industry from different perspectives, our Management Team has established close working relationships with the best trainers in racing today. Additionally, that experience also encompasses selecting the best horses at the sales and personally breaking and training each horse. We combine all those skills to provide an educated process of choosing the best trainer and program for each horse going to the track. As humans, what is suitable for one horse may not be optimal for another.
What makes your business different from the others?
TTM offers a full cycle of investment opportunities allowing our investment partners to keep everything under one umbrella. Our clients love that when their horse leaves the sale for breaking and training or needs to rehabilitate, or even rest from the track for a bit, they are in one location under our watchful eyes. Each of us brings different skills to the table. By combining our strengths, we can provide exceptional services backed by years of educational and hands-on experience.

Katie grew up around her parents’ Thoroughbred Training facility in Ocala. She earned a Bachelor’s Degree in Biology at the University of Tennessee/Martin, where she rode on their Division 1 NCAA Equestrian team. Katie went on to earn a Master’s degree in Animal Science at the University of Florida, after which Katie began assisting her father in their breaking and training business. In 2019, Katie opened White Lilac in Ocala, where she caters to clients looking for a boutique experience from a trainer. In addition to breaking and training, Katie has vast expertise in sales prepping weanlings and yearlings, pinhooking, and rehabilitation.
